About the role

The Fire Protection Design Manager will be responsible for general supervision of all design/BIM aspects of new construction sprinkler projects.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for project management duties for each project and/or delegation to appropriate team member
  • Reviews design drawings for compliance with NFPA codes and project specifications
  • Reviews material submittals for compliance with NFPA codes and project specifications
  • Reviews hydraulic calculations for compliance with NFPA codes and project specifications
  • Reviews and procures all material stock lists for construction projects
  • Coordinates material delivery with customer and field superintendent
  • Supervises designer's tasks and schedules
  • Reviews designer drawings to comply with department standard
  • Monitors design hours for profitability/efficiency
  • Supervises field measuring process with designers
  • Participates in regularly scheduled department meetings to review progress on current projects and future project needs
  • Assists FP sales team with bid take off as needed
  • Coordinates and resolves design conflicts with field superintendent
  • Conducts job "kick-off" meetings for superintendent and field crews
  • Coordinates regular FP department meetings
  • Reviews and approves vendor material invoices for construction
  • Coordinates permit process with local Authority Housing Jurisdiction (AHJ)
  • Coordinates and reviews shop drawing process with A/E
  • Maintains "design" file for each construction project
  • Coordinates with FP service staff for small/day work projects
  • Ensures that proper safety and incident reporting procedures are followed and brings problems to supervisor, safety, or HR
  • Performs other duties as assigned
